if (d) mp_copy(d);
p = strongprime_setup(name, d, &f, nbits, r, n, event, ectx);
if (!p) { mp_drop(d); return (0); }
j.j = &f;
p = pgen(name, p, p, event, ectx, n, pgen_jump, &j,
if (d) mp_copy(d);
p = strongprime_setup(name, d, &f, nbits, r, n, event, ectx);
if (!p) { mp_drop(d); return (0); }
j.j = &f;
p = pgen(name, p, p, event, ectx, n, pgen_jump, &j,